    AnnotationThe aim of this study was to evaluate the efficiency of feeds with the addition of various algae and cyanobacteria. Common carp (average body mass of 19.6 ± 3.49 g) were randomly divided into 4 groups and fed a commercial feed (control group), the same commercial feed with the addition of 10 % of dry green algae of the genus Chlorella (chlorella group), dry biomass of algae from waste water treatment (algae group), and lyophilized toxic cyanobacterial biomass of the genus Microcystis (microcystis group). After 29 days of the experiment, standard indices for the assessment of feed utilization, external characteristics, fish condition, chemical composition of muscles and composition of fatty acids were measured. The feed variants with the addition of green algae (chlorella and algae groups) appeared to be nutritionally more favorable in our experiment. A higher content of PUFAs and total amount of fats (expressed in units of weight) were found in the groups of fish fed the green algae and algae from waste water treatment supplemented feed.
